This volume of Viz's 2-in-1 edition collects the 13th and 14th installments of Yoshiyuki Sadamoto's classic manga adaptation of the landmark anime series. As the story hurtles toward its apocalyptic conclusion, Shinji, Rei, and Asuka confront the terrifying truths behind NERV, the Angels, and the Human Instrumentality Project. This edition also includes the bonus story 'The Shinji Nobody Knows' and full-color pages from the original Japanese releases.
